Lessons We Can Take Away From Today
In this episode, I sit down with Pouya Ashfar, a visual artist, animator, professor, and proud Iranian American. We talk about how art can be an outlet for grief, the push, and pull of having two identities, the first generation of two immigrants; he also shares some behind-the-scenes knowledge of creating animated series.
